Cargill commemorates nationwide action on Surakshit Khadya Abhiyan' with Walkathon Drive

Cargill India today, took the ‘Food Safety Pledge’ in association with the Confederation of Indian Industry (CII), Consumer Voice and NASVI to commemorate the nationwide action on Surakshit Khadya Abhiyan to promote access to Safe and Hygienic Food for all. The first walkathon to support the initiative was held at the Jawaharlal Nehru Stadium on Lodi Road this morning. The Surakshit Khadya Abhiyan Walkathon witnessed more than 3,000 enthusiasts across all age groups walk a 4 km stretch.

Eminent dignitaries gathered on Sunday morning to support the event. Mr Satyendar Jain, Minister of Health, Industry and Power, Government of NCT of Delhi flagged off the walkathon at 8:30 am amidst a lot of cheering and support from RJ Peeyush, Fever 104 FM, RJ Sid, Fever 104 FM; and the Bollywood actor, Avijit Dutt. Besides the walkathon, various interesting events including a Nukkad Natak, on the spot painting competition and on the spot quiz contest were held with an objective to create awareness around safe and hygienic food.

Mr Siraj Chaudhry, Chairman, Cargill India Pvt. Ltd said, “Cargill is dedicated to nourishing people and our goal is to provide high-quality, safe food every time, everywhere. We are glad to join hands with CII as National Industry Partner and be a catalyst to improve food safety awareness in the country as well as drive the agenda of ‘safe food as everyone’s right’ through the Surakshit Khadya Abhiyan. The response towards today’s walkathon drive has been very encouraging.” He further added, “Cargill Walkathon has a vision towards sensitizing consumers, street food operators and industry on their roles, rights, importance of hygienic practices and systems for food safety risk mitigation.”

Mr Satyendar Jain, Minister of Health, Industry and Power, Government of NCT of Delhi said, “Food safety is mandatory in national capital and Delhi government will run a month long campaign to address for food adulteration. Nutrition, Hygiene Awareness and Food Safety plays a vital role in all walks of life. The government is extending full support to this campaign to make it successful.”

Cargill India will be supporting various advocacy programs as well as walkathons across the country, which are designed as part of the Surakshit Khadya Abhiyan mission and will work closely with CII-FACE, Industry and Government in designing appropriate sector specific Good Manufacturing Standards and help Risk Mitigation in the Food Chain.
